summaryrefslogtreecommitdiff
path: root/net-analyzer/nmap/files/nmap-9999-constify-continued.patch
blob: 04738f408231113ec2e097299f4bca9217e051ad (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
--- a/libnetutil/EthernetHeader.cc
+++ b/libnetutil/EthernetHeader.cc
@@ -284,7 +284,7 @@ int EthernetHeader::setEtherType(u16 val){
 
 
 /** Returns destination port in HOST byte order */
-u16 EthernetHeader::getEtherType() const {
+const u16 EthernetHeader::getEtherType() const {
   return ntohs(this->h.eth_type);
 } /* End of getEtherType() */
 
--- a/scan_engine.cc
+++ b/scan_engine.cc
@@ -166,7 +166,7 @@ extern "C" int g_has_npcap_loopback;
 #endif
 
 
-int HssPredicate::operator() (const HostScanStats *lhs, const HostScanStats *rhs) const {
+const int HssPredicate::operator() (const HostScanStats *lhs, const HostScanStats *rhs) const {
   const struct sockaddr_storage *lss, *rss;
   lss = (lhs) ? lhs->target->TargetSockAddr() : ss;
   rss = (rhs) ? rhs->target->TargetSockAddr() : ss;